> Can anyone explain why time has todays date and time zone?

Works for me:

regression=# insert into periods values(1,1,'now','now');
INSERT 0 1
regression=# select * from periods;
 periodid | periodnumber |  periodstart   |   periodend
----------+--------------+----------------+----------------
        1 |            1 | 16:13:14.35962 | 16:13:14.35962
(1 row)

I speculate that you are trying to display the table in some client
software that doesn't know the time datatype and is forcibly converting
it to something it does know.
